Job Summary:
Bond Williams Limited is seeking a highly skilled Quality Control Technician to join their team in a manufacturing environment. As a Quality Control Technician,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the quality of supplied components and products meets the highest possible standard.
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ct thorough testing on incoming, in-progress, and outgoing materials to identify any non-conformities and report them to the relevant teams.
- Document test results and provide feedback to the production and supply teams to ensure quality standards are met.
- Identify subtle differences and trends in quality data to contribute to solutions that maintain the highest possible quality standards.
- Input data to enable rapid and accurate responses to quality and production-related queries.
Requirements:
- Ability to work effectively in a small team of 3-4 Quality Control Technicians, collaborating to ensure processes are followed properly.
- Excellent time management skills, attention to detail, and ability to multitask.
- Previous laboratory or cleanroom experience, particularly in Quality Control, is advantageous, although not essential, as full training will be provided.
